Ticket: BLQ-412 — Expired creds on bloomgate

The bloom filter sidecar fronting the Kestrelstore KV cluster stopped refreshing membership snapshots Tuesday. Root cause: the service credential it uses against the snapshot API expired and nobody owns rotation. False-negative rate is climbing, so reads are hammering Kestrelstore directly. Patch attached wires in the rotated credential via env injection. For review, the replacement key is below.

app token of yajof-fajof = zpat11_OrsDd3gqCaG

Subject: Reportly sort-stability cut-over — done

Hey all, quick wrap-up for the sync. We cut Reportly over to the stable-sort engine Thursday night. Rows with equal keys now keep their input order, so the flaky snapshot tests finally pass. Saw a ~4% render slowdown on huge reports, within budget. Old comparator stays behind a flag for two weeks, then it's gone. For reference, here's the configuration the report service is running with now.

settings of fafog-haduf:
ZORIX_PIN=4648
ZORIX_METRICS_HOST=metrics.zorix.paliqsys.corp
ZORIX_LOG_LEVEL=info
ZORIX_TENANT=druix

Q3 Planning — Reseller Programme. Velstrom Partners tier restructure goes live mid-quarter. Margins tighten on bronze; gold partners get co-marketing funds. Drop underperformers in the Harkvale region by week six. Pipeline targets unchanged. Marit owns onboarding; Deylan owns renewals. No public announcement until partner kits ship. Full details on next steps are set out in the note below.

board note of faduf-tawef: The board signed off on a budget of $14.4 million for Project Tamion. The renewal with Druaelek Logistics closes at $54.7 million a year, 13 percent above the last contract.

☐ Payroll export flip (v3 → v4) — Welbridge team. Before cutting the release, run one v4 export against the staging ledger and eyeball the new column order; finance will notice before you do, trust me. Keep the v3 writer behind its flag for one more cycle in case Thornsby Accounting needs a rollback. Record the approved build token for this step below.

pipeline stamp: htk3_69f